1.Origin:

The origin of Indian Chai dates back to ancient times, with its roots intertwined in the vast tea plantations of Assam and Darjeeling (in India). Tea cultivation saw a significant boost during the British colonial era which led to its widespread consumption across the Indian subcontinent. 

2.The Art of Indian Chai Preparation:

The preparation of flavourful traditional Indian Chai requires skill and finesse. Every individual preparing chai has his/her unique approach to making Chai. The secret family recipes are passed down through generations. 

The traditional process starts with boiling water and adding tea leaves, sugar and spices together before adding milk. The concoction simmers until the flavors amalgamate which produces a beverage that captivates the senses and awakens the mind.

4.Variations of Chai: 

Traditional Indian Chai is such a top seller that with time many variations of this delightful beverage have been introduced to cater to different palates. Some of the most sought-after variations are: 

(i). ‘Masala Chai’- The traditional chai infused with additional spices like black pepper and fennel creates a bold and more aromatic blend which is the masala chai. 

(ii). ‘Ginger Chai’ – The traditional chai simmered with ginger in it makes the famous ginger chai. 

(iii). ‘Cardamom Chai’- This chai is the one which has the subtle sweetness of cardamom infused in it.

(iv). ‘Iced Chai’ – This cold beverage variation of hot chai has gained popularity in recent times. It is especially relished in the warmer climates offering a refreshing and creamy alternative to chia lovers. 

(v). ‘Chai Latte’ – Chai Latte is the frothy latte indulgence of the traditional chai.

Kulfi- A must try Indian dessert

Indian desserts are known for diverse and rich flavors which have a lasting impression on the taste buds and leave you longing for more. Nothing quite compares to the heavenly indulgence of the Indian classics of Kulfi. It is a traditional Indian frozen dessert which tantalizes the taste buds with its rich creamy texture. It is made by simmering sweetened milk to the point it thickens. This thickened milk is flavored like mango, pistachio and cardamom and then frozen. 1. Mango Kulfi:

Mango Kulfi is a delectable frozen dessert which captures the essence of the king of fruits – Mango. It is prepared from pureed ripe mangoes and milk with a dash of cardamom. This hearty Indian dessert is a crowd-puller which can be relished in summers.

2. Tilla Khoya Kulfi:

Tilla Khoya Kulfi is a rich and velvety milk and dry fruits kulfi. This luxurious kulfi involves simmering milk for hours until it reduces and thickens to form khoya (a solidified milk delicacy). Cardamom, saffron and nuts are then added to khoya and frozen into kulfi molds. Tilla Khoya Kulfi is a creamy and aromatic delight. The finely chopped almonds and pistachios add that nutty crunchiness.

3. Pista Kulfi:

Pista Kulfi imbibes the irresistible flavors of pistachios. This kulfi variant is made from ground pistachios, milk, sugar and cardamom to form a luscious and nutty delight. The kulfi has a vibrant green color which is derived from the pistachios. It is a sore treat for both the eyes and the taste buds. It is sweet and crunchy goodness combined together.

4. Kulfi Falooda:

Kulfi Falooda combines the creamy goodness of kulfi and the refreshing falooda. The base is a kulfi topped with vermicelli noodles soaked in rose syrup. Garnishing of sweet basil seeds, chopped nuts, and a generous drizzle of rose syrup makes it a heavenly indulgence.

Masala Dosa

The fame of this dish has been growing for some time. Originally, it was a part of Tuluva Mangalorean cuisine. Dosas are thin and crispy and originate from the South. Dosa can be made by mixing fermented rice with lentils. Potatoes, curry leaves, and methi makes up the dosa filling, which adds even more flavor. It would be a great choice any day to eat this vegan Indian food item.

Aloo Gobi

Aloo gobi is a favorite and best Indian dish with cauliflower and potatoes. Some spices that give a warm flavor are turmeric, cumin, and coriander. A mix of onions, potatoes, and cauliflower is cooked till tender and then mixed and heated with ginger, garlic, onion powder and extra chilli. There are a number of vitamins and fibers in this dish.

Dal Makhani

Every home in India usually prepares dal almost every day. Vegans will love the vegan version of this dish. To make non-dairy Dal Makhani like the ones served in cafes, simply replace kidney beans with black beans. One of the many dal curry varieties growing in fame is Dal Makhani. This dish is rich in protein since black lentils and red kidney beans are combined.

Kofta

Meatballs are called koftas. Nevertheless, vegetarian and vegan kofta varieties are common in India.

A vegan kofta often includes lentils, potatoes, or mixed vegetables. Curry or gravy usually accompanies kofta. Vegan gravy can be substituted for creamy gravy.

Gulab Jamun

Gulab Jamun is one of the popular Indian dishes that make every occasion perfect. Prepared with milk solids kneaded into a dough, then shaped like small balls and deep-fried. The balls are then soaked in sugar syrup and offer a sweet taste.

Aloo Tikki

Aloo Tikki is another famous Indian street food loved by people in India. It is just a potato cutlet served with Yoghurt and Indian spices and extrachilli to make it tempting and delicious. To attract more and more people, it is served with khati-mithi chutney.

Samosa Chaat

Next on our list is samosa chaat which is everyone’s favorite dish, especially people who love junk food. Samosa is topped with chana, yoghurt, chutney, and various other spices to give flavour to the taste buds. 

Biryani

Biryani is the favourite dish prepared at festivals and is loved by almost everyone you can say worldwide. It can be made both veg and non-veg and prepared with basmati rice and various seasonal vegetables.

Ras malai

Ras malai is a sweet dessert that has the ability to make every occasion, big or small perfect. It is prepared with small balls of cottage cheese soaked in sweetened milk. After that, these balls are seasoned with cardamom and saffron.
